Protecting Personal Information
One of the primary concerns in online gaming is the protection of personal data. Gamers often share sensitive information, including payment details and personal identification, when they create accounts or make purchases. Cybersecurity measures such as encryption and secure authentication protocols are vital in safeguarding this data from unauthorized access.

Preventing Fraud and Cheating
Fraud and cheating are significant issues in online gaming, affecting both the gaming experience and the platform's integrity. Cybercriminals may use various techniques to exploit vulnerabilities, such as creating fake accounts or deploying bots to manipulate game outcomes.
To counter these threats, gaming platforms employ a range of cybersecurity strategies, including real-time monitoring and behavioral analysis. Securing Transactions and Payments
In-game purchases and transactions are integral to many online games, and securing these transactions is crucial for both the player and the platform. Cybersecurity practices such as tokenization and secure payment gateways help protect financial transactions from interception or tampering.

Defending Against DDoS Attacks
Distributed Denial of Service (DDoS) attacks are a common threat to online gaming platforms. These attacks flood servers with excessive traffic, causing disruptions or making the platform inaccessible. Implementing effective DDoS mitigation strategies is essential for maintaining uptime and ensuring a smooth gaming experience.

Ensuring Fair Play
Maintaining fairness in online gaming is crucial for player satisfaction. Cheaters and hackers can ruin the gaming experience by exploiting vulnerabilities or using unauthorized modifications. Cybersecurity measures are implemented to detect and prevent such actions, ensuring that all players compete on an even playing field.
